While the plugin came with 20 sample HDRIs to get you started, version 1054 was optimized to handle GreyscaleGorilla’s “Expansion Packs” that contained over 300 unique, high-quality HDRIs. It could seamlessly manage packs like Pro Studios Metal (for shiny surfaces), Ultimate Skies (for outdoor rendering), and Commercial Locations .
